摘要
Educational technology is a medium that has the potential to improve the effectiveness of teaching and learning. The rapid pace of change in educational technology such as mobile learning (m-learning) had given the prodigious impact towards the world of education. This paper explores and discusses on the definition of mobile learning with its suitable learning environment, affordances and potential of this approach with its limitations. The post-millennials or Generation Z had been labeled as 'student of m-era' in this paper. In addition, this article also reviewed critically on the previous studies that demonstrate on the favorable and adverse effect of mobile learning in teaching and learning, implies that this advent paradigm of pedagogy approach helps students in teaching and learning process in various ways predominantly if proper executions have been applied. Some practical strategies and methods of implementation of m-learning approach despite of its limitations and challenges were recommended in this paper as well. This review study can become a comprehensive guidance or reference for policy makers, educators, and researchers in the field who are curious about and intend to initiate or adopt m-learning.
